Infection via the portal system(portal pyemia) : The infectious process originates within the abdomen and reaches the liver by entering the portal vein. Appendicitis and pylephlebitis are the predominant causes. However, any source of intra-abdominal abscess, such as acute diverticulitis, inflammatory bowel disease, and perforated hollow viscus, can lead to portal pyemia and hepatic abscesses. 2, record 2, English, - portal%20pyemia
